Background / History

Jeanne was educated by the Church and received at least a high-school education at a Church academy. The soul of the historical Jeanne resides in her body, granting her physical abilities and strength far beyond those of ordinary humans. She initially sought recognition through the Hero Faction after accomplishing little within the Church. 6 66 101

She first encountered Ren during a vampire incident at a Roman bar. Disguised in delinquent-style clothing, she posed as Ren’s cousin to keep a vampire away from him, then revealed herself as the historical Jeanne’s successor. 5

As a Hero Faction member, Jeanne recruited Ren and passionately advocated the group’s goal of proving humanity equal to gods, devils, and angels. Her conviction was weakened after Ren argued that heroes exist to protect others rather than seek achievement or glory, and after Katerea Leviathan mocked the faction for relying on Ophis and the Khaos Brigade. 7 65 66

Jeanne later discovered that the Hero Faction was willing to disrupt peace and attack mythological factions to develop Sacred Gears. She concluded that its ideology had become terrorism, began secretly providing Ren with intelligence, and eventually openly opposed Cao Cao during the Kyoto incident. 101 127 147

After helping Ren rescue victims of Romanian vampire blood factories, Jeanne found a practical meaning for heroism in protecting civilians. She redirected Hero Faction members from an attack on Greek mythology toward destroying the blood factories instead. 129 130

Following Cao Cao’s defeat, Jeanne became a founding member of Ren’s Brotherhood. She took responsibility for recruiting members in Europe, though this work ultimately drew the Hero Faction’s attention and led to her capture alongside Le Fay Pendragon. 149 255 256

Personality

Jeanne is earnest, proud of her identity, and initially highly enthusiastic about the Hero Faction’s grand ideals. Her passionate recruitment speeches and embarrassment when challenged about the faction’s lack of resources reveal both her sincerity and naivety. 7

Her understanding of heroism changes significantly after working with Ren. Seeing humans imprisoned in vampire blood factories leaves her deeply guilty over having pursued glory while others suffered; she subsequently commits herself to protecting people rather than pursuing recognition. 66 101 129

Despite her idealism, Jeanne can be practical and decisive. She recruited available Hero Faction members to dismantle the Romanian blood factories, developed a backup plan with Yasaka when she distrusted Ren’s approach, and recognized Ren’s role in the Himejima Family incident through logical deduction. 130 143 156

Story Role / Major Arcs

Rome Vampire Incident

Jeanne meets Ren in a vampire bar, reveals her identity, and witnesses him eliminate the attacking vampires with overwhelming speed and skill. 5 6

Hero Faction Recruitment

She invites Ren into the recently established Hero Faction and explains its stated mission to elevate humanity. Ren’s skepticism exposes the faction’s lack of organization, resources, and clear structure. 7

Khaos Brigade Investigation

Jeanne assigns Ren to verify Ophis’s existence in Romania and accompanies him to Khaos Brigade headquarters. Confrontations with Ren and Katerea cause her to question whether the Hero Faction’s ideals are genuine. 64 65 66

Break with Cao Cao

After learning that the Hero Faction planned to create conflict and exploit battles to strengthen Sacred Gears, Jeanne accepts that its actions contradict real heroism. She informs Ren of its plans and agrees to work against Cao Cao. 101 127
